Day 1 - Welcome to Singapore!
Upon arrival, your private car and driver await to whisk you to your choice of city-center hotel.
Day 2 - Out and about in the city
With your private guide, discover the city’s rich historic legacy and the vibrant pace of modern life. Begin in Little India and continue past Parliament and City Hall, reminders of Singapore’s Colonial heritage. Ascend Mt. Faber and visit the Botanic Garden. Ride the Singapore Flyer, enjoy a treatment at the Fish Spa and sample the signature dishes at Desire. Continue through the lanes of Tao Payoh and Geylang for a fascinating look at daily life and the tempting, multi-ethnic foods of these always-busy city neighborhoods. Meals B,L
Day 3 - A night on the town
Enjoy a day at leisure. This evening, your private guide will take you to the Singapore City Gallery to marvel at an impressive architectural scale model of the city. Visit the Chinatown Heritage Center where old Chinese shophouses, carefully restored, offer insight into city life nearly 200 years ago. Stop by one of the city’s famous food hawker centers for dinner by your own arrangement and then thrill to the Song of the Sea, a multi-sensory extravaganza of music, pyrotechnics and a live cast. Meals B
Day 4 - Depart Singapore
Transfer to the airport by private car. Meals B
